Carrot Cake Bread
A delightful blend of cake-like sweetness and quick-bread simplicity, capturing the flavors of traditional carrot cake.

Ingredients
1 1/3
cups
all-purpose flour
1
teaspoon
ground cinnamon
1/4
teaspoon
ground nutmeg
1/2
teaspoon
ground ginger
1/4
teaspoon
salt
2 1/2
teaspoons
baking powder
2
large
eggs
room temperature
1/2
cup
granulated sugar
1/4
cup
brown sugar
1/2
cup
vegetable oil
1
teaspoon
vanilla extract
2
cups
grated carrots
1/2
cup
chopped pecans
4
ounces
cream cheese
room temperature
4
tablespoons
unsalted butter
softened
1 1/2
cups
powdered sugar
1/4
teaspoon
vanilla extract
1
pinch
salt
Instructions
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ease a 9x5 inch loaf pan and line with parchment paper.
In a medium bowl, whisk together flour, cinnamon, nutmeg, ginger, salt, and baking powder.
In a large bowl, mix eggs, granulated sugar, brown sugar, vegetable oil, and vanilla extract until blended.
Fold in grated carrots and pecans, then g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et mixture until just combined.
Pour the batter into the prepared loaf pan and smooth the top. Bake for 50–55 minutes or until a toothpick comes out clean.
Let the loaf cool completely in the pan before glazing.
To make the glaze, beat cream cheese and butter until smooth. Add powdered sugar, vanilla extract, and a pinch of salt, mixing until creamy.
Microwave the glaze for 20 seconds to make it pourable, then drizzle it over the cooled carrot cake bread.
Notes
Store at room temperature for up to 3 days or refrigerate for up to 5 days. Freeze for up to 3 months.
